3 Movie Tickets For National Cinema Day

Approximately 95% of U.S. cinemas and plenty of U.K. cinemas are set to participate in National Cinema Day, an inaugural event taking place on Saturday, September 3rd.

The one-day-only event was just announced by The Cinema Foundation, a non-profit arm of the National Association of Theater Owners, and will feature all movie tickets at only $3.

That price includes all premium format screens like ScreenX, IMAX and more. More than 3,000 theaters and more than 30,000 screens in North America are participating in the event, including AMC and Regal, along with all major studios. In the UK, 550 cinemas will be participating with tickets priced at £3.

Before each showing, ticket buyers will be shown a sizzle reel of upcoming films from A24, Amazon, Disney, Focus Features, Lionsgate, Neon, Paramount, Sony and Sony Classics, United Artists, Universal, and Warner Bros.

Labor Day weekend is traditionally one of the slowest weekends in theaters but that could change with this. Organizers of National Cinema Day say this ‘trial’ event could become an annual fixture.
